# Farewick Shipping Rules Engine — environment configuration
#
# The rules engine evaluates fee tables in priority order; RULES_EVAL_MODE
# should stay "strict" in production so conflicting rules fail loudly
# rather than silently picking the first match. RULES_CACHE_TTL_SECONDS
# controls how long compiled rule sets are reused — lowering it increases
# load on the rules store. The engine fetches rule definitions from the
# Corvane config service, which requires an access credential, supplied on the next line.

secret setting of hawep-yahig: LEDGER_TOKEN29=41b5d6315371c92885eaeb077fb63

Hi Renna,

Handing over FixtureForge releases while I'm out. The test-data factory lib is stable — just watch the seeded-randomness flag, it trips new contributors. Cut 2.9 on Thursday, notes are drafted in the Maplewick wiki. CI handles publishing once you approve the gate. You'll need to sign the package manifest; use the release signing key below.

deploy key for bagep-kagep: bky13_ABLWxSKvV95h9

## Hot-reloading configuration (Corvid service)

Corvid watches its config directory and reloads on file change without restart. Reloads are atomic: if validation fails, the old config stays active and a warning is logged. Do not edit files in place on the host — push through the deploy pipeline so changes are versioned. After any reload, verify the active config hash in the health endpoint matches what you pushed. The validation rules and rollback procedure are documented here.

operations page: https://jenkins.zemvarcloud.local/job/merge_requests/repo/build/73930b4b30f0a8ed

Runbook — Garagewatch occupancy feed

The feed from the Dellbrook garage sensors publishes every 20s to the `occupancy.raw` topic. If the dashboard shows stale counts, check the normalizer pod first; it silently drops malformed frames. Restart order: collector, normalizer, aggregator — never aggregator first, it replays the full window. Gaps under 2 minutes self-heal. Longer gaps require a manual backfill from the sensor gateway's buffer, which holds six hours. Before touching anything, confirm the running config matches what is recorded here.

deployment values, tafof-taduf:
pelius:
  pin: 6508
  tenant: praiel
  seal: seal_4e33a2f4
  metrics_host: metrics.pelius.plorvagrid.corp
  standby_team: druix
  escalation: juldor-norius
  nonce: 5db598